## Further Reading

The Hollowgate validator plugin system loads plugins at startup from the manifest; each plugin declares its schema version and supported check types. Version mismatches fail closed. If you're adding a new validator, start with the scaffold in the examples directory and register it in the manifest before writing logic. Lifecycle hooks, sandboxing rules, and the deprecation policy for older plugin APIs are all covered on the internal design page.

wiki page, tahaf-tajog: https://jira.ordindyn.corp/pipeline

/*
 * Cache invalidation settings for the Lanternleaf catalog.
 * When a product record changes, stale entries may persist
 * until TTL expiry or an explicit purge. Support: if a
 * customer reports outdated pricing, these windows explain
 * the maximum delay before correction. The governing
 * constants are defined immediately below:
 */

tuning table, kajog-bawip:
TIERS = {
    "kelius": 256,
    "lammir": 543,
}

## Authentication

EchoDock (audio-guide app for the Vellarine Museum) uses short-lived bearer tokens issued by the Tonewalk identity service. Tokens expire after 30 minutes; refresh is silent via device attestation. No credentials are stored on the kiosk tablets. All requests hit TLS 1.3 endpoints only. Scope is read-only for exhibit audio; curator endpoints require a separate grant. For local review, use the staging token below.

portal login ticket: eyJhbGciOiJIUzI1NiIsInR5cCI6IkpXVCJ9.eyJzdWIiOiI0Z4ywpUMsBIn0.ca5FVhkdBXa3

## Data stores: incremental static rebuilds

For the security review: the Quillpage rebuild pipeline tracks content hashes per page in a small metadata database, so only changed pages are regenerated. No user data is stored here — just slugs, hashes, and build timestamps. Write access is limited to the build worker role; reviewers get read-only credentials. The metadata store is reachable with the connection string below.

database URL for bagap-yahap: mysql://druax_svc:s0i8rHw@db-fdc1.orvexworks.local:5432/druius